Overview

The Police & Crime Commissioner for Warwickshire on behalf of Warwickshire Police has awarded a contract for database monitoring services. This was a direct award via NEPO framework NEPRO3 Specialist Professional Services reference Contract_16747 and as such is PCR 2015 compliant. The call off is for initial period of 12 months with option to extend for a further 12 months.
